Caleb Sparks is currently a Maker Lab Teacher's Assistant at Santa Clara University, having started in September 2023. Previously, Caleb held the position of Robotics Intern at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ory, where contributions included developing an algorithm for real-time detection of radar scan coverage gaps and integrating this algorithm into the team’s codebase. Caleb also worked as an Undergraduate Research Assistant at Active Safety for Semi-Autonomous and Autonomous Vehicles, focusing on optimizing system models using Model Predictive Path Integral Control. Other internships included roles at Intuitive, Daimler Trucks North America, and DEUTZ Corporation, where achievements encompassed energy tracking systems for hybrid trucks, subsystem development for automotive features, and creating data analytics environments for predicting part failures. Caleb holds a Master of Science in Mechanical Engineering from Santa Clara University (2023 - 2025) and a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ering from the Georgia Institute of Technology (2018 - 2022).

Located 40 miles south of San Francisco in California’s Silicon Valley, Santa Clara University offers rigorous undergraduate curricula in the arts and sciences, business, and engineering. It has nationally recognized graduate and professional schools in business, law, engineering, pastoral ministries, counseling psychology, education, and theology.
